Mathsketball

  1. Students all stand in a circle around one student who has a piece of paper crumpled into a ball.
  2. The students standing around the student in the center all make circles with their arms (as if each student is a basketball hoop) and in their hands hold out a piece of paper with a number on it so that the student in the middle can see it.
  3. The teacher (or a fellow student) will say a number out loud and the student in the middle must shoot the crumpled piece of paper into the arms of multiple students whose number all add up to the number given (e.g. the number given is 14 so the students shoots the paper ball into hoops of others holding up 7, 5, 2).
  4. Do this with multiple students, and get more complicated if necessary (multiplication, etc).
